Product Overview:
Titanium pentasilicide (Ti₅Si₃) is a black powder with an extremely high melting point (2130°C) and a density of 4.10 g/cm³. It exhibits excellent chemical stability, making it ideal for high-temperature applications. Due to its low resistivity and superior properties, titanium pentasilicide has broad potential applications in several high-tech fields.
Product Features:
- Low Resistivity:Performs excellently in thin-film resistor applications within the microelectronics industry.
- High Melting Point:Melting point up to 2130°C, making it suitable for high-temperature environments.
- Strong Chemical Stability:Maintains stability in extreme environments, ensuring reliable performance.
